---
title: Constants
sidebar_label: Constants
---

Null values, infinity, and numeric limits from [`io.deephaven.util.QueryConstants`](/core/javadoc/io/deephaven/util/QueryConstants.html).

| Type     | Name                | Signature                                                                         | Description                            |
| -------- | ------------------- | --------------------------------------------------------------------------------- | -------------------------------------- |
| CONSTANT | MAX_BYTE            | [byte](/core/javadoc/io/deephaven/util/QueryConstants.html#MAX_BYTE)              | Maximum value of type byte.            |
| CONSTANT | MAX_CHAR            | [char](/core/javadoc/io/deephaven/util/QueryConstants.html#MAX_CHAR)              | Maximum value of type char.            |
| CONSTANT | MAX_DOUBLE          | [double](/core/javadoc/io/deephaven/util/QueryConstants.html#MAX_DOUBLE)          | Maximum value of type double.          |
| CONSTANT | MAX_FINITE_DOUBLE   | [double](/core/javadoc/io/deephaven/util/QueryConstants.html#MAX_FINITE_DOUBLE)   | Maximum finite value of type double.   |
| CONSTANT | MAX_FINITE_FLOAT    | [float](/core/javadoc/io/deephaven/util/QueryConstants.html#MAX_FINITE_FLOAT)     | Maximum finite value of type float.    |
| CONSTANT | MAX_FLOAT           | [float](/core/javadoc/io/deephaven/util/QueryConstants.html#MAX_FLOAT)            | Maximum value of type float.           |
| CONSTANT | MAX_INT             | [int](/core/javadoc/io/deephaven/util/QueryConstants.html#MAX_INT)                | Maximum value of type int.             |
| CONSTANT | MAX_LONG            | [long](/core/javadoc/io/deephaven/util/QueryConstants.html#MAX_LONG)              | Maximum value of type long.            |
| CONSTANT | MAX_SHORT           | [short](/core/javadoc/io/deephaven/util/QueryConstants.html#MAX_SHORT)            | Maximum value of type short.           |
| CONSTANT | MIN_BYTE            | [byte](/core/javadoc/io/deephaven/util/QueryConstants.html#MIN_BYTE)              | Minimum value of type byte.            |
| CONSTANT | MIN_CHAR            | [char](/core/javadoc/io/deephaven/util/QueryConstants.html#MIN_CHAR)              | Minimum value of type char.            |
| CONSTANT | MIN_DOUBLE          | [double](/core/javadoc/io/deephaven/util/QueryConstants.html#MIN_DOUBLE)          | Minimum value of type double.          |
| CONSTANT | MIN_FINITE_DOUBLE   | [double](/core/javadoc/io/deephaven/util/QueryConstants.html#MIN_FINITE_DOUBLE)   | Minimum finite value of type double.   |
| CONSTANT | MIN_FINITE_FLOAT    | [float](/core/javadoc/io/deephaven/util/QueryConstants.html#MIN_FINITE_FLOAT)     | Minimum finite value of type float.    |
| CONSTANT | MIN_FLOAT           | [float](/core/javadoc/io/deephaven/util/QueryConstants.html#MIN_FLOAT)            | Minimum value of type float.           |
| CONSTANT | MIN_INT             | [int](/core/javadoc/io/deephaven/util/QueryConstants.html#MIN_INT)                | Minimum value of type int.             |
| CONSTANT | MIN_LONG            | [long](/core/javadoc/io/deephaven/util/QueryConstants.html#MIN_LONG)              | Minimum value of type long.            |
| CONSTANT | MIN_POS_DOUBLE      | [double](/core/javadoc/io/deephaven/util/QueryConstants.html#MIN_POS_DOUBLE)      | Minimum positive value of type double. |
| CONSTANT | MIN_POS_FLOAT       | [float](/core/javadoc/io/deephaven/util/QueryConstants.html#MIN_POS_FLOAT)        | Minimum positive value of type float.  |
| CONSTANT | MIN_SHORT           | [short](/core/javadoc/io/deephaven/util/QueryConstants.html#MIN_SHORT)            | Minimum value of type short.           |
| CONSTANT | NAN_DOUBLE          | [double](/core/javadoc/io/deephaven/util/QueryConstants.html#NAN_DOUBLE)          | Not-a-Number (NaN) of type double.     |
| CONSTANT | NAN_FLOAT           | [float](/core/javadoc/io/deephaven/util/QueryConstants.html#NAN_FLOAT)            | Not-a-Number (NaN) of type float.      |
| CONSTANT | NEG_INFINITY_DOUBLE | [double](/core/javadoc/io/deephaven/util/QueryConstants.html#NEG_INFINITY_DOUBLE) | Negative infinity of type double.      |
| CONSTANT | NEG_INFINITY_FLOAT  | [float](/core/javadoc/io/deephaven/util/QueryConstants.html#NEG_INFINITY_FLOAT)   | Negative infinity of type float.       |
| CONSTANT | NULL_BOOLEAN        | [Boolean](/core/javadoc/io/deephaven/util/QueryConstants.html#NULL_BOOLEAN)       | Null boolean value.                    |
| CONSTANT | NULL_BYTE           | [byte](/core/javadoc/io/deephaven/util/QueryConstants.html#NULL_BYTE)             | Null byte value.                       |
| CONSTANT | NULL_BYTE_BOXED     | [Byte](/core/javadoc/io/deephaven/util/QueryConstants.html#NULL_BYTE_BOXED)       | Null boxed Byte value.                 |
| CONSTANT | NULL_CHAR           | [char](/core/javadoc/io/deephaven/util/QueryConstants.html#NULL_CHAR)             | Null char value.                       |
| CONSTANT | NULL_CHAR_BOXED     | [Character](/core/javadoc/io/deephaven/util/QueryConstants.html#NULL_CHAR_BOXED)  | Null boxed Character value.            |
| CONSTANT | NULL_DOUBLE         | [double](/core/javadoc/io/deephaven/util/QueryConstants.html#NULL_DOUBLE)         | Null double value.                     |
| CONSTANT | NULL_DOUBLE_BOXED   | [Double](/core/javadoc/io/deephaven/util/QueryConstants.html#NULL_DOUBLE_BOXED)   | Null boxed Double value.               |
| CONSTANT | NULL_FLOAT          | [float](/core/javadoc/io/deephaven/util/QueryConstants.html#NULL_FLOAT)           | Null float value.                      |
| CONSTANT | NULL_FLOAT_BOXED    | [Float](/core/javadoc/io/deephaven/util/QueryConstants.html#NULL_FLOAT_BOXED)     | Null boxed Float value.                |
| CONSTANT | NULL_INT            | [int](/core/javadoc/io/deephaven/util/QueryConstants.html#NULL_INT)               | Null int value.                        |
| CONSTANT | NULL_INT_BOXED      | [Integer](/core/javadoc/io/deephaven/util/QueryConstants.html#NULL_INT_BOXED)     | Null boxed Integer value.              |
| CONSTANT | NULL_LONG           | [long](/core/javadoc/io/deephaven/util/QueryConstants.html#NULL_LONG)             | Null long value.                       |
| CONSTANT | NULL_LONG_BOXED     | [Long](/core/javadoc/io/deephaven/util/QueryConstants.html#NULL_LONG_BOXED)       | Null boxed Long value.                 |
| CONSTANT | NULL_SHORT          | [short](/core/javadoc/io/deephaven/util/QueryConstants.html#NULL_SHORT)           | Null short value.                      |
| CONSTANT | NULL_SHORT_BOXED    | [Short](/core/javadoc/io/deephaven/util/QueryConstants.html#NULL_SHORT_BOXED)     | Null boxed Short value.                |
| CONSTANT | POS_INFINITY_DOUBLE | [double](/core/javadoc/io/deephaven/util/QueryConstants.html#POS_INFINITY_DOUBLE) | Positive infinity of type double.      |
| CONSTANT | POS_INFINITY_FLOAT  | [float](/core/javadoc/io/deephaven/util/QueryConstants.html#POS_INFINITY_FLOAT)   | Positive infinity of type float.       |

## Related documentation

- [Auto-imported functions](./index.md)
